Different Cooling Systems

Advanced cooling systems are increasingly being integrated into laptops to address the rising demands of video editing workloads. Here are some of the most common cooling systems found in modern laptops:

  • Heat Pipes and Fins:
  • Heat pipes and fins are commonly used in laptops to dissipate heat from the processor and graphics card. By circulating heat between the components, heat pipes and fins help maintain optimal temperatures, ensuring consistent performance and preventing overheating.

  • Cooling Fans:
  • Cooling fans are a critical component in most laptops, responsible for providing airflow to dissipate heat from the components. The fan’s rotational speed, combined with the design of the laptop’s casing, plays a significant role in determining the laptop’s overall cooling performance.

  • Radiators and Liquid Cooling:
  • Radiators and liquid cooling systems are typically found in high-performance laptops, designed to provide enhanced cooling for demanding workloads. By circulating liquid coolant through a radiator, these systems can achieve higher heat dissipation rates than traditional air-cooled systems.

Ports and Their Roles

The role of ports such as USB-C, Thunderbolt, and HDMI in laptop usability cannot be overstated. Each of these ports serves a distinct purpose, catering to different needs and applications.

USB-C Ports

The USB-C port is a versatile port that has become increasingly prevalent in modern laptops. It can support multiple functionalities, including data transfer, power delivery, and display output. With speeds of up to 10 Gbps, USB-C ports offer a significant upgrade over traditional USB-A ports, making them an attractive option for video editors who require rapid data transfer.

Thunderbolt Ports

Thunderbolt ports are another high-speed interface that can be found on many modern laptops. They offer speeds of up to 40 Gbps, making them ideal for applications that require high-bandwidth data transfer, such as video editing and 3D modeling. Thunderbolt ports can also be used to daisy-chain multiple devices, further increasing their utility.

HDMI Ports

HDMI ports are widely used for connecting external displays and projectors. They offer a reliable and high-quality way to output video and audio to external devices, making them an essential feature for video editors who require a dedicated external display.

Technical Requirements for 4K and 8K Video Editing

To edit 4K and 8K video, laptops require significantly more compute power than those used for 1080p editing. The main reasons for this are:

Higher resolution

4K and 8K resolutions have quadruple and sixteen times the number of pixels, respectively, compared to 1080p. This increase in pixel count demands more processing power to handle the increased computational load.

Increased file size

4K and 8K video files are much larger than their 1080p counterparts, which puts additional pressure on storage and memory resources. Laptops need to be equipped with ample storage and memory to handle these larger files.

Greater color depth and fidelity

4K and 8K video often employ 10-bit or 12-bit color depth, allowing for more nuanced and accurate color representation. This increased color fidelity requires more processing power to ensure smooth rendering and playback.

Key Features to Look for in a Budget-Friendly Laptop for Video Editing

When searching for a budget-friendly laptop, there are specific features to look for to ensure you get the best value for your money. Here are some key factors to consider:

  • Processor: Opt for an Intel Core i5 or i7 or an AMD Ryzen 5 or 7 processor for decent performance. Integrated graphics can be sufficient for lower-end video editing tasks.
  • RAM: Ensure the laptop has at least 8GB of RAM, although 16GB or more is recommended for smooth performance.
  • Storage: A 256GB or 512GB solid-state drive (SSD) is ideal for video editing, as it provides faster load times and can handle demanding video files.
  • Display: A 13.3-inch or 14-inch display with a resolution of 1080p or higher can provide a good balance between portability and screen real estate.
  • Ports: Ensure the laptop has multiple USB-A ports, an HDMI port, and an SD card reader for connecting peripherals and transferring files.
  • Weight and Portability: A laptop weighing under 3.5 pounds can offer decent portability, making it easier to carry to shoots or editing sessions.

Can a laptop with an integrated graphics card be used for video editing?

While it’s technically possible to use a laptop with an integrated graphics card for video editing, it may not provide the best performance or experience. Integrated graphics cards are designed to conserve power and battery life, but they can struggle with demanding video editing tasks. For optimal performance, a dedicated graphics card is recommended.
